Study Notes

The Life of Christ

  • Jesus' response to Mary's question: "Did you not know that I must be in my Father's house?"
  • Jesus returned to Nazareth with his family, maintaining a quiet, uneventful life
  • Mary kept these events in her heart
  • Pope Benedict XVI noted Jesus' explanation "I must be in my Father's house"
  • Jesus' "must" refers to his readiness to submit to God's will
  • Jesus' words often exceed rational understanding, stemming from a realm outside experience
  • Understanding Jesus requires gradually increasing maturity and responding like Mary
  • Jesus increased in wisdom, stature, and favor with God and man
  • Hidden years, filled with prayer, allow for fellowship with Jesus
  • Catechism of the Catholic Church encourages imagining these years to enter daily life with Jesus
  • Citations include Matthew 2:1-23, Luke 2:1-52, Philippians 2:5-8, Micah 5:2, and Jeremiah 31:15.
